当前位置:首页 > 行业动态 > 正文

域名服务器端口被占用意味着什么问题?

域名服务器端口被占用意味着该端口已经被其他进程或服务使用,导致域名服务器无法正常工作。

域名服务器端口被占用的意思

域名服务器端口被占用意味着什么问题?  第1张

域名服务器端口概述

定义:域名服务器(DNS服务器)是负责将域名转换为IP地址的服务器,在互联网中,DNS服务器起到了至关重要的作用,确保用户能够通过易记的域名访问网站。

默认端口:域名服务器默认使用的端口是53,该端口用于接收客户端发来的DNS请求,并返回相应的解析结果。

端口被占用的原因

原因 描述
程序冲突 其他程序或服务占用了默认的域名服务器端口,导致冲突。
配置错误 域名服务器的端口可能在配置文件中被其他应用程序或服务误用。
防火墙设置 域名服务器的端口可能被防火墙阻止访问或被认为是不安全的。
反面软件 可能存在反面软件或干扰感染导致域名服务器端口被占用。
资源限制 系统资源限制,如内存或处理能力不足,也可能导致域名服务器端口被占用。

端口被占用的影响

性能下降:当服务器端口被占用时,网络通信受阻,降低服务器的处理能力,可能导致响应时间延长,影响用户体验和业务效率。

安全风险:端口占用增加了服务器遭受攻击的风险,反面用户可能会利用被占用的端口进行非规访问、数据窃取或其他反面行为。

资源浪费:端口的占用需要消耗一定的系统资源,如内存和CPU,大量端口被占用时,会导致服务器资源过度消耗,降低整体性能。

解决端口被占用的方法

方法 描述
检查占用情况 使用网络工具如netstat、lsof等查看当前系统中所有的网络连接和监听端口,确定哪个程序或服务占用了域名服务器所需的端口。
停止占用程序 通过关闭相应的程序或服务来释放被占用的端口,可以使用操作系统提供的管理工具、命令行工具或任务管理器来停止对应的程序或服务。
修改端口配置 如果系统中存在多个域名服务器程序,可以选择关闭其中一个程序,或者修改其中一个程序的端口配置,避免端口冲突。
更新杀毒软件 安装和更新杀毒软件,定期进行系统扫描,及时清除网络中的反面软件或干扰,避免它们占用域名服务器端口。
重启计算机 重启计算机是解决端口被占用的最直接有效的方法,因为它会强制释放占用的端口。

域名服务器端口被占用是指用于传输域名解析相关信息的端口被其他程序或服务占用,导致域名服务器无法正常工作,这种情况会影响域名解析和网站访问的功能,为了解决这一问题,可以采取检查端口占用情况、停止占用程序、修改端口配置、更新杀毒软件和重启计算机等措施。

0